The present invention relates to a shock absorption structure for a motor vehicle, the shock absorption structure comprising a metal beam and a resin cushion provided on the side of the metal beam that receives an external shock, the resin cushion being provided in a longitudinal center portion including the metal beam, the metal beam includes a portion that receives an external impact within a range in the length direction of the metal beam. According to the present invention, impact energy from the outside is appropriately dispersed and transmitted to a metal beam over a wide range via a resin cushion disposed by a simple method without using a high-level bonding technique, and the amount of impact energy absorbed is greatly increased compared to the case of a single metal beam. The increase in the impact energy absorption amount is efficiently performed so that the weight increment of the impact absorption structure is suppressed to be small.
